About the technology
What GNU Make does
GNU Make is a build automation tool that reads rules from a Makefile. It compares file timestamps and dependencies, then runs only the commands needed to produce targets such as binaries, libraries, generated files or documentation. Its concise syntax works well for repeatable local builds and automated pipelines.
Makefile design
Strong Makefiles express dependencies clearly and separate configuration from commands. Professionals use variables, pattern rules, include files, automatic variables and phony targets to keep larger build systems understandable. They also control quoting, shell behavior, parallel execution and failure handling instead of relying on fragile command chains.
- Model source, generated-file and package dependencies
- Add reusable targets for build, test, clean and release tasks
- Support local, cross-platform and cross-compilation workflows
- Document required tools and configuration for contributors
Ecosystem and tooling
GNU Make commonly coordinates GCC or Clang, linker tools, archivers, code generators and scripting languages. It can sit beside Autoconf, Automake, CMake, Meson or Ninja, either as the main interface or as part of a wider toolchain. Experts also connect it with Git, container builds, package managers and CI systems such as GitHub Actions, GitLab CI or Jenkins.
When expertise helps
Companies often bring in freelance specialists when a legacy Makefile has become difficult to change, builds are slow or results differ between machines. Expertise is also valuable during a migration from another build system, a move to cross-compilation, or the introduction of reproducible builds and automated release steps.
- Untangle circular, implicit or missing dependencies
- Reduce unnecessary rebuilds and improve parallel execution
- Port builds across Linux, macOS, Windows or embedded environments
- Connect Make targets with tests, packaging and deployment pipelines

Signs of strong professionals
The best GNU Make specialists understand the commands behind each target, not only the Makefile syntax. They inspect dependency graphs, shell exit behavior, environment variables and toolchain versions before changing rules. They add focused validation, explain trade-offs and leave a build process that other specialists can maintain without guesswork.

GNU Make automates tasks that depend on files or other targets. Companies use it to compile source code, link binaries, generate documentation, run tests, package releases and coordinate repeatable commands in local or CI environments.
GNU Make is a direct build tool: teams write the dependency rules and commands in Makefiles. CMake and Meson usually generate build files from higher-level project descriptions, while Ninja focuses on fast execution; the right choice depends on portability, project structure and existing tooling.
A strong GNU Make professional usually understands shell scripting, Git, compiler and linker toolchains, Unix environments and CI configuration. Familiarity with C or C++, cross-compilation, containers and tools such as CMake or Autotools can also be important.

Ask the specialist to explain dependency resolution, incremental builds, pattern rules, parallel execution and shell error handling. Good work includes clear targets, predictable configuration, useful diagnostics and tests that prove the build behaves consistently on a clean environment.
No. GNU Make runs on Linux, macOS and Windows environments, although shell commands and available tools can differ. A careful professional isolates platform-specific behavior, documents prerequisites and uses CI coverage to detect portability problems.
